Untitled is a watercolor drawing by Anne Chu. It dates from 1999 and is held in the collection of the Museum of Modern Art.

About this work

Overview

Created in 1999, this untitled watercolor on paper belongs to the collection of the Museum of Modern Art. Although Anne Chu is chiefly recognized for three‑dimensional works that combine fabric, metal, porcelain and other materials, this piece demonstrates her engagement with two‑dimensional media, offering a brief, gestural glimpse into her broader artistic concerns.

Subject & Meaning

The composition presents a dominant, loosely rendered tree that occupies most of the surface, its mass suggested by irregular, sweeping strokes. Two diminutive, darkened figures appear at the left edge, their presence understated against the expansive arboreal form, hinting at a narrative of scale and perhaps the relationship between humanity and nature.

Technique & Style

Executed with watercolor, the work relies on flat, vivid hues of green, blue and brown applied in rapid, uneven washes. The brushwork is intentionally sketchy, leaving edges indistinct and forms blurred, which conveys a sense of immediacy and spontaneity rather than meticulous finish. The texture emphasizes gesture over detail.

History & Provenance

The piece entered the Museum of Modern Art’s holdings shortly after its creation, becoming part of the institution’s representation of late‑20th‑century American art. Its acquisition reflects MoMA’s interest in documenting the diverse practices of artists known primarily for sculpture who also explored drawing and painting.

Context

During the late 1990s, many artists expanded beyond their primary mediums, experimenting with drawing and painting to explore ideas that might not translate directly into sculpture. Chu’s watercolor aligns with this trend, offering a two‑dimensional counterpart to the tactile, material investigations evident in her sculptural oeuvre.
